Transaction 302827a64e05f5e34340fadbb2321c4e99a7b701c56f70446814482fc67853a5
1 Input
2 Outputs
- 302827a64e05f5e34340fadbb2321c4e99a7b701c56f70446814482fc67853a5:0
- 302827a64e05f5e34340fadbb2321c4e99a7b701c56f70446814482fc67853a5:1
value 3537945
address 3FstC6DTRyqqcKL92Lnfic3DqL1YHvaAeV
value 34862192
address 1CAvACRDGh1UdGaqs3yTufhNTD7YJUskEw